Pangi Valley

Current Context : Pangi Valley is set to benefit from improved snow-clearing operations with the introduction of a state-of-the-art truck-mounted snow blower machine.

About Pangi Valley

  • Remote valley in Chamba district, located between Zanskar and Pir Panjal ranges at ~11,000 feet elevation.
  • Known for harsh winters with 3,000–4,700 mm snowfall (Dec–March), often isolating the region.
  • Population comprises Aryan descendants (Rajputs, Brahmins) and Mongolian-origin Bhots.

Black Sea

Current Context : In a significant environmental crisis, Russian authorities have declared a federal-level emergency in response to a catastrophic oil spill along the Black Sea coast.

About Black Sea

  • Location: A body of water bordered by six countries: Bulgaria, Romania, Ukraine, Russia, Georgia, and Turkey. It is connected to the Mediterranean Sea through the Bosporus Strait, the Sea of Marmara, and the Dardanelles Strait.
  • Hydrography: Low salinity, anoxic deeper layers with hydrogen sulfide.
  • Rivers: Drained by major rivers such as the Danube, Dniester, and Don.
  • Geopolitical Importance: Strategic for trade routes, military access, and energy transport.
  • Ecology: Hosts diverse species like dolphins and sturgeon, despite anoxic depths.

Current Context : As of November 2024, the Rupee’s Real Effective Exchange Rate (REER) of the Indian rupee reached 108.14, a rise from 107.20 in October 2024. This is the highest REER level in 2024.

Overvaluation Implication: A REER above 100 indicates the rupee is overvalued relative to the 2015-16 base year, reducing export competitiveness and making imports cheaper.

REER vs NEER:

  • NEER: Nominal Effective Exchange Rate; reflects the weighted average of bilateral exchange rates with multiple trading partners but does not account for inflation.
  • REER: Adjusts NEER for inflation differences between domestic and foreign economies, providing a better measure of currency competitiveness. 

Calculation: REER = NEER × (Domestic Price Index ÷ Foreign Price Index).

Currency Basket: The indices now include 36 currencies, up from 6, reflecting India’s broader trade relations.

Canary Islands

Current Context : Over 10,000 migrants died in 2024 attempting to reach Spain by sea, making it one of the deadliest years for migration.

About the Canary Islands

  • Location: Spanish archipelago, 62 miles west of Morocco, in the Atlantic Ocean.
  • Main Islands: Lanzarote, Fuerteventura, Gran Canaria, Tenerife, La Gomera, La Palma, El Hierro.
  • Political Status: Part of Spain and EU’s outermost regions.
  • Climate: Subtropical, warm temperatures, minimal seasonal variation. Influenced by the Canary Current.

Current Context : Under the shadow of China’s plan to build the world’s largest dam, India pushes for a counter project in Arunachal Pradesh.

About the Upper Siang Hydropower Project

  • Location: Upper Siang district, Arunachal Pradesh, India, on the Siang River (upper Brahmaputra).
  • Capacity: Proposed 11,000 MW hydropower plant.
  • Developers: NHPC (National Hydroelectric Power Corporation) and NEEPCO (North Eastern Electric Power Corporation).
  • Project Cost: Estimated ₹1,13,000 crore.
  • Reservoir Storage: 9 billion cubic meters (BCM).
  • Strategic Purpose: Countermeasure to China’s proposed 60,000 MW dam on the Yarlung Tsangpo (Brahmaputra) in Tibet.
  • Local Impact: Area inhabited by Adi Tribe; relies on ‘pani kheti’ (settled agriculture) for sustenance.

Current Context : Recently, strong Western Disturbances brought snow to parts of Himachal Pradesh, Uttarakhand causing changes in weather.

About Western Disturbances

  • Extra-tropical storms originating in the Mediterranean region, moving eastward and bringing winter rain to north-western parts of the Indian subcontinent.
  • Movement: Carried eastward by westerly winds, particularly the Subtropical Jet Stream.
  • Weather Impact: Cause rain, snow, or hailstorms in northern and northwestern India.

Significance for India :

  • Agriculture: Crucial for Rabi crops like wheat and mustard.
  • Glacier Replenishment: Aid in replenishing glaciers in the Himalayan region.

Asbestos

Current Context : Recently, the U.S. FDA proposed new rules to ensure cosmetics are free from asbestos contamination, especially in talc-containing products.

About Asbestos

  • Asbestos is a group of naturally occurring mineral fibers, primarily used for their heat and corrosion resistance.
  • Types: There are six main forms of asbestos; chrysotile(white asbestos) is the most commonly used.
  • Applications: Used in building materials, automobile industry, and various industrial products due to durability and heat resistance.

Health Risks: Exposure to asbestos can cause:

  • Lung Cancer
  • Laryngeal Cancer
  • Ovarian Cancer
  • Mesothelioma(a rare cancer affecting the pleura and peritoneal linings).

PM CARES Funds

Current Context : PM CARES (Prime Minister’s Citizen Assistance and Relief in Emergency Situations Fund) Funds received Rs 912 crore crore in 2022-23, as per the latest audited accounts.

About PM CARES Funds 

Prime Minister’s Citizen Assistance and Relief in Emergency Situations Fund.

Purpose: To provide relief and assistance during emergencies, calamities, and public health crises such as natural disasters, pandemics, and accidents.

Legal Framework:

  • Registered under the Registration Act, 1908as a Public Charitable Trust.
  • Not funded by government budget allocations, operates separately.

Governance:

  • The Prime Minister is the ex-officio Chairperson of the fund.
  • Membersinclude the Defence MinisterHome Minister, and Finance Minister.
